Raikkonen plays down Ferrari issues

Kimi Raikkonen has denied that Ferrari have major problems, instead claiming that it was just an off weekend for his team. Ferrari’s form has taken a turn for the worse after winning the opening two races with Sebastian Vettel at the wheel. Raikkonen has already had to retire from races twice this season with reliability problems, including last time out in Spain. On the other hand, Mercedes form has returned, and Lewis Hamilton has won the last two races, propelling him to a 17-point lead at the top of the drivers’ standings.
